The NATO Secretary General called for preparations for a long war in Ukraine and named the condition under which this will not happen

    NATO must prepare for a long war in Ukraine.

    This was stated by NATO Secretary General Jens Stoltenberg in an interview with the German media group Funke, published on September 17.

    He believes that “most wars last longer than expected when they started,” so the Alliance must prepare for a long war in Ukraine.

    We all strive for a fast world. At the same time, we must realize: if President Zelensky and the Ukrainians stop fighting, their country will cease to exist. If President Putin and Russia lay down their arms, we will have peace,” the Secretary General expressed this opinion not for the first time.

    In addition, Stoltenberg noted that after the end of the war, Ukraine should receive security guarantees so that Russian aggression against it does not happen again:

    The peace agreement should not serve as a respite for Russia to attack again. We can no longer allow Russia to jeopardize security in Europe.

    At the same time, Stoltenberg added that “there is no doubt that Ukraine will eventually be in NATO.”

    At the same time, he did not name the exact timing of the country’s entry into the alliance. At the July NATO summit in Vilnius, Ukraine, contrary to expectations, did not receive an invitation to join the alliance. At the same time, the declaration signed at the end of the summit stated that the G7 countries undertake to ensure the defense capability and security of Ukraine on the basis of long-term bilateral agreements.

    Speaking about the growing costs of European countries for the supply of weapons to Ukraine, Stoltenberg said:

    During the Cold War, under Konrad Adenauer or Willy Brandt, defense spending accounted for three to four percent of economic output.

    We did it then, and we must do it again today,” he urged, noting that in his home country of Norway, defense spending has fallen short of the 2% target committed by NATO member states.

    Stoltenberg added that during his years as head of the Norwegian government, he realized “how difficult it is to allocate more money to defense when higher spending on health, education or infrastructure is needed.”
